Borivali to Goa

Updated: 24 May 2026

The journey from Borivali to Goa covers approximately 600 km. You can take a direct train from Borivali or travel to Dadar/Thane for more options. Buses are also available. The route takes you through the scenic Konkan coast. Expect a travel time of 10 to 14 hours by train. The Mumbai-Goa highway is the primary road route.

Total Distance: Driving distance is 600 km; straight-line air distance is 450 km.
Fastest Way
Tejas Express is the fastest and most convenient way.
Cheapest Way
Train in Sleeper class is the most affordable way to travel.

Best Time to Travel

November to February, when the weather is pleasant.

Things to Do in Goa
1
Baga Beach
A popular beach in North Goa, known for its nightlife and water sports.
2
Basilica of Bom Jesus
A UNESCO World Heritage site, famous for its baroque architecture.
3
Dudhsagar Falls
A stunning waterfall, perfect for a day trip.
4
Panjim City
The capital of Goa, known for its colonial architecture and vibrant culture.
